PASADENA, Calif. -- The third-ranked Cal Lutheran women's water polo squad had 12 different players find the back of the net in their 19-4 win over Caltech on Wednesday afternoon in a SCIAC match-up.
The Regals scored four goals during their first five possessions and never looked back from there. Cal Lutheran ended the first period up 6-1 five different players scoring goals.
Anastasia Markovtsova scored the first goal of the second period to bring Caltech within 6-2 but the visitors scored three unanswered goals to finish out the stanza in taking a 9-2 edge at intermission.
Cal Lutheran continued their scoring push by scoring the first six goals of the third period in helping them take a commanding 15-3 lead into the final period.
The final eight minutes of action saw the Regals post a 4-1 scoring edge to close out the contest.
The Regals got hat tricks from a pair of players as Christina Messer and Illissa Mestas each scored three goals.
Carly Bond scored her first two goals of the season for the Beavers while goals by Markovtsova and Hanna Dodd rounded out the Caltech contributors.
Connie Hsueh blocked 12 shots for the Beavers. It was the eighth time this season the first-year recorded 10 or more blocks in a game.
